Title: | Methods of treatment of pterygium using an anti-VEGF agent |
Abstract: | Methods for treating pterygium recurrence following pterygiectomy, and for treating keloid recurrence, following surgical removal of the keloid, are disclosed. The methods include administering an anti-VEGF agent (e.g., antibody (e.g., bevacizumab) or small molecule inhibitor of VEGF signaling), or a combination therapy that includes co-administering an anti-VEGF agent, with an anti-inflammatory steroid and/or a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) to a subject. |
